8.01 Other Events

 

On June 8, 2018, the Registrant entered into a six month consulting agreement with Regal Consulting LLC, organized under the laws of Delaware, for corporate communications services aiding the Company to introduce planned and varied fintech platforms. Compensation to Regal includes payment of its fee of $150,000 with 15,000,000 restricted common shares.
